 Operated by BEA from 1950 to 1959-12-09. Shell Aircraft 1960-01-04. Dan Air from 1966-06-03.

On 30 September 1968, after a touch-and-go landing at Gatwick Airport, the right main gear didn't lock up. As a result of a wheels-up landing on a foam carpet at Manston, the aircraft was damaged beyond repair.
